Windows 11 and Windows 10 don't include a dedicated PDF text editor out of the box, which surprises many users. But between Microsoft Edge, Microsoft Word, and a lightweight desktop editor, you have several solid offline ways to edit a PDF on Windows. This guide covers each free built-in route and then the most capable local solution, PDF Agile.

Free General Methods to Resolve This Task

Method 1: Free Built-in Windows PDF Editing Routes

Windows ships with tools that handle light PDF edits without any download:

  • Microsoft Edge (Built-in): Windows' default PDF viewer lets you draw, highlight, and add text notes. Open the PDF in Edge, use the Draw and Highlight tools, then save. It cannot edit existing text.
  • Microsoft Word (Office): Open the PDF in Word to convert it to an editable document, make your edits, and save back as PDF. Best for text; complex layouts may shift.
  • Microsoft Print to PDF (Built-in): After marking up or covering content, use the Microsoft Print to PDF virtual printer to flatten the page into a clean new file.

Does Windows 11 have a built-in PDF editor?

Windows 11 includes Edge for viewing and basic markup, but no built-in editor for changing existing PDF text. A desktop app like PDF Agile fills that gap.

How do I edit a PDF on Windows without Adobe?

Use Microsoft Edge or Word for light edits, or install an affordable desktop editor like PDF Agile for full editing without Adobe's subscription.

Can I edit a PDF on Windows offline?

Yes. Edge, Word, and PDF Agile all work fully offline, keeping your files on your PC.
